How far is Avignon from Hamburg?

The distance from Avignon to Hamburg is 703.8 miles (1132.6 km) as the crow flies. Hamburg is located NNE of Avignon. By car, the driving distance is approximately 844.5 miles, taking about 16h 59min. A direct flight would take roughly 1h 55min. Avignon is in France, while Hamburg is in Germany.
